The Keys of the Kingdom

US (1944): Drama/Religious

An early role for a perfectly cast Gregory Peck earned him his first Oscar® nomination. Peck portrays a Scottish missionary doing God's work in a China beset by war and poverty. Also features Roddy McDowall as the missionary's boyhood self. Adapted by Nunnally Johnson from the novel by A. J. Cronin. John M. Stahl directs a cast that includes Thomas Mitchell, Vincent Price, Edmund Gwenn, Cedric Hardwicke, Peggy Ann Garner, James Gleason and Anne Rivere. (20th Century-Fox) (amctv.com)


· Actor 1945: Gregory Peck
· Interior Decoration (Black and White) 1945: James Basevi & William S. Darling - Art Direction, Thomas Little & Frank E. Hughes - Set Decoration
· Cinematography (Black and White) 1945: Arthur C. Miller
· Music Scoring Awards (Scoring of a Dramatic or Comedy Picture) 1945: Alfred Newman

4 nominations
